Acadiana's own Buckwheat Zydeco will perform on "Willie Nelson: The Library of Congress Gershwin Prize for Popular Song' on PBS tonight, January 15. Buckwheat joins Edie Brickell, Leon Bridges, Rosanne Cash, Ana Gabriel, Jamey Johnson, Alison Krauss, Raul Malo of The Mavericks, Neil Young, Promise of the Real, and past recipient Paul Simon in tribute to Willie Nelson, who is also a beloved member of the Country Music Hall of Fame.

The Library of Congress Gershwin Prize for Popular Song is named in honor of the legendary songwriters George and Ira Gershwin, and recognizes the huge effect of popular music on the world's culture. Past winners include Stevie Wonder, Paul McCartney, Billy Joel, Burt Bacharach and Hal David, and Carole King.

The tribute will air January 15 at 8:00 PM CST, and will be made available to our men and women in uniform overseas on the Armed Forces Network at a later date.
